Since India won the cricket World Cup in 2011, the Board of Control for Cricket in India (BCCI) wants to make sure that happens again in 2023, when the whole tournament will be held in India. Also, this conclusion was reached at a meeting that took place not too long ago in Mumbai. The future of Indian cricket up until the World Cup was talked about for more than four hours in a hotel in Mumbai by its head coach Rahul Dravid; India’s captain Rohit Sharma, the head of the National Cricket Association (NCA); VVS Laxman, and the outgoing chief selector, Chetan Sharma. The goal of the meeting was to come up with a plan for how to improve cricket in India in the future.

The National Cricket Association (NCA) will also work with a club from the Indian Premier League (IPL) to keep an eye on the players who have been singled out and to make sure that players in this group are as fit as possible. The twenty players who were chosen to fill the last spot on the team’s roster will now take turns taking part in the different activities that are coming up. Because of this, all of the players will be sure to get enough playing time before the World Cup. The Board of Control for Cricket in India (BCCI) has decided that the Yo-Yo test will be the main measure of fitness, and there will be no leniency when it comes to the players’ fitness.
